def ProvisionDevice(device_serial, is_perf, disable_location):
device = device_utils.DeviceUtils(device_serial)
device.old_interface.EnableAdbRoot()
_ConfigureLocalProperties(device, is_perf)
device_settings_map = device_settings.DETERMINISTIC_DEVICE_SETTINGS
if disable_location:
device_settings_map.update(device_settings.DISABLE_LOCATION_SETTING)
else:
device_settings_map.update(device_settings.ENABLE_LOCATION_SETTING)
device_settings.ConfigureContentSettingsDict(device, device_settings_map)
device_settings.SetLockScreenSettings(device)
if is_perf:
# TODO(tonyg): We eventually want network on. However, currently radios
# can cause perfbots to drain faster than they charge.
device_settings.ConfigureContentSettingsDict(
device, device_settings.NETWORK_DISABLED_SETTINGS)
# Some perf bots run benchmarks with USB charging disabled which leads
# to gradual draining of the battery. We must wait for a full charge
# before starting a run in order to keep the devices online.
try:
battery_info = device.old_interface.GetBatteryInfo()
except Exception as e:
battery_info = {}
logging.error('Unable to obtain battery info for %s, %s',
device_serial, e)
while int(battery_info.get('level', 100)) < 95:
if not device.old_interface.IsDeviceCharging():
if device.old_interface.CanControlUsbCharging():
device.old_interface.EnableUsbCharging()
else:
logging.error('Device is not charging')
break
logging.info('Waiting for device to charge. Current level=%s',
battery_info.get('level', 0))
time.sleep(60)
battery_info = device.old_interface.GetBatteryInfo()
device.RunShellCommand('date -u %f' % time.time(), as_root=True)
